Due to the increase of intentionally damaged devices over the last few years, we have had to make the following changes in order to sustain a 1:1 program (where each student has a device assigned). This shift also reflects our goal of teaching students responsibility and care for the tools they use daily. Just like textbooks or other school materials, students are expected to treat their devices with respect and take ownership of their condition. We also ask that parents are involved and check devices often to know the status and condition of assigned devices and accessories.

We will no longer process any “warranty coverage” or “warranty claims.” All damage, regardless of how it occurred—will be treated the same. Damage is damage. To help families understand the process, please refer to the Damage Chart (below), which outlines the steps and associated costs for each incident. As part of our updated policy, the first and second damage incidents now carry a reduced cost compared to previous years, while still encouraging responsible device care.

All parents and guardians are asked to review the new process for technology devices.
